Description

A vibrant, nutrient-packed salad celebrating spring’s best produce. Balanced flavors, bright colors, and a homemade basil-garlic dressing elevate this quick, satisfying meal.


Ingredients

Scale

1 bunch asparagus, tough ends trimmed
½ cup frozen peas (no need to thaw)
A few generous handfuls of mixed salad greens (butter lettuce, arugula, or spinach)
2 radishes, thinly sliced
½ cup crumbled feta cheese
½ avocado, sliced
¼ cup chopped toasted pistachios
½ cup roasted chickpeas (canned, drained, patted dry, and roasted with olive oil & salt at 400°F for 20 mins)
Fresh herbs like dill or mint, for garnish
Sea salt and freshly ground black pepper
¼ cup fresh basil leaves, packed
1 small garlic clove
¼ cup extra-virgin olive oil
2 tbsp fresh lemon juice
1 tbsp apple cider vinegar (substitute for red wine vinegar to meet dietary requirements)
1 tbsp honey


Instructions

Trim asparagus and roast on a baking sheet at 400°F for 10-12 minutes until tender-crisp.
Blanch peas by roasting them with chickpeas for 20 minutes at 400°F (no need to thaw). Prepare greens, radishes, and avocado.
To make the dressing, blend basil, garlic, olive oil, lemon juice, apple cider vinegar, and honey until smooth.
Toss all salad ingredients together and drizzle with dressing just before serving.
Garnish with chopped herbs and additional pistachios.

Notes

Roast chickpeas and asparagus ahead for quicker assembly. Adjust dressing sweetness by adding honey gradually.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
